Somali and Omani Transport Ministers Discuss Finalization of Airspace Agreement

Muscat (SONNA) – The Minister of Transport and Civil Aviation of the Federal Government of Somalia, Fardowsa Osman Igall, along with her delegation, participated in the ICAO Security Week conference held in Muscat, Oman. During the conference, Minister Igall met with the Minister of Transport, Communications and Technology of the Sultanate of Oman, H.E. Eng. Hamood Saeed Al Mawaali.

The discussions centered on the strong relationship and brotherhood between Somalia and Oman in the fields of transport and aviation. Key topics included the completion of the Somalia-Oman Airspace Agreement, with a particular focus on creating new opportunities in trade, tourism, and investment.

Minister Igall highlighted the extensive investment opportunities available in Somalia, not only in transport and aviation but also in critical infrastructure such as roads, ports, and other areas of mutual benefit. The two ministers emphasized the importance of further strengthening relations between the two nations.

In a significant development, Minister Igall extended an invitation to H.E. Eng. Al Mawaali to visit Somalia within the month, which he graciously accepted.

The meeting also explored opportunities for technical cooperation in crucial areas of civil aviation, including capacity building, aviation security, safety, and air navigation services.

Minister Igall expressed her gratitude to the Sultanate of Oman for the warm welcome extended to her and her delegation during the ICAO Security Week event. She underscored the importance of this event in advancing global aviation safety and reiterated the commitment to enhancing bilateral relations and fostering mutually beneficial cooperation between Somalia and Oman.
